The abbreviation for kilovolt is kV. One kilovolt is equal to 1,000 volts, and this unit is commonly used in electrical engineering and power distribution to measure high voltages.

The unit of measure for electrical pressure forcing electrical energy through a conductor is volts (V). It represents the potential difference or electromotive force between two points in a circuit, driving the flow of current.

Electrical pressure, or voltage, is measured using a device called a voltmeter. The voltmeter is connected in parallel to the circuit or component being measured, and it provides a numerical reading of the voltage present in the system. Voltage is typically measured in units of volts (V).
Pascals measure pressure, which is the force applied to a specific area. It is the standard unit for expressing atmospheric pressure, blood pressure, and other forms of pressure in various systems.
